## Environments — Haltern Kiosk Watchdog

The Haltern kiosk app runs a watchdog sidecar on every retail unit. In staging, the watchdog restarts the app on any heartbeat miss so testers see failures quickly; in production it waits for three consecutive misses to avoid restart loops during slow network windows. Maintainers changing these thresholds should update both environments together, since past drift caused confusing field reports. The production watchdog values currently in effect are recorded below for reference.

settings of tagag-fajeg:
[quenion]
host = quenion.ordingrid.corp
user = quenion_svc
database = quenion_prod

**Building Access — Intern Cohort Arrival Week (Pellbridge Campus)**

Visiting contractors should note that during the week the Stonemere Analytics intern cohort arrives, the main lobby of Pellbridge East will be reserved for group check-in each morning between 08:00 and 10:30. Contractors are asked to use the north annex entrance during this window and to sign in at the annex desk, where escort arrangements will be confirmed. To release the annex door during these hours, enter the code below.

badge for fafop-fajof: bdg-Z-47

Subject: Quickstore 4.2 — bloom filter now fronts the KV layer

Plugin authors: starting with this release, Quickstore places a bloom filter ahead of the key-value store. Negative lookups return faster; false positives fall through safely. No API changes are required on your side. Verify your plugin against the staging build referenced below.

session token of fahif-tadup = htk3_9c7

## Changelog — Seat-Map Renderer (Changed Defaults)

The Gildercrest seat-map renderer for the Marrowlight Theatre now defaults to vector rendering rather than tiled bitmaps. This improves zoom fidelity on balcony sections but increases initial render cost for houses over two thousand seats. We also lowered the default label density so row markers no longer overlap in the stalls view. Operators who relied on the old bitmap path must opt back in explicitly. The new default configuration is as follows.

deployment values, fawef-kajep:
[jorwyn]
host = jorwyn.torvaio.example
user = jorwyn_svc
database = jorwyn_prod